An award-winning artist, Antonio is a native of the Dominican Republic where he studied theatre at the School of Dramatic Arts, co-hosted/produced and directed for the award-winning television show FashionTV, was a contributing writer for M.S. Magazine, an art director for various fashion campaigns, and a director/performer for various national productions. Favorite NYC acting credits include: The Stranger to Kindness (Robert Moss Theater; Winner Congeniality Award, Nominated Best Actor), The Empress of Sex (Audience Favorite National NewBorn Festival), Arpeggio (45th St Theatre), Intermission (HERE),Trojan Women (MHS), Elevation (Payan Theatre), OOPS!(Manhattan Theatre Source), 4 Variations of Mee(Manhattan Children's Theatre), Ilka's Dream (Payan Theatre). Favorite directing credits include The Family Shakespeare, The Shadow Project, Edward Albee's The Zoo Story, Oscar Wilde's The Importance of Being Earnest, Rafael Morla's Joan. As a singer he has performed at The Town Hall of NY, Symphony Space NY, The Time Out Lounge, The Triad NYC and The Nuyorican Poets Cafe; he also sings with Voices in Unity. 

He is the owner of Fab Marquee Productions; a founding member and company actor for MTWorks and currently serves as their Marketing Director; a contributing writer for The Happiest Medium, and a member of Voices in Unity. His photography has been featured in the NY Times, the NY Post, Backstage, Show Business Weekly, among others.  Currently he studies voice with Susan Baum and continues his performance studies at The Juilliard School.
